Question

The numerator of a fraction is 7 less than its denominator. If the denominator is increased by 9 and the numerator by 2, the fraction becomes 23. Find the fraction.

Solution
Verified by Toppr

Let the numerator be x and

the denominator be y

Given that numerator of a fraction is 7 less than its denominator

Therefore, x+7=y ------(1)

Given that if the denominator increased by 9 and the numerator by 2 then the fraction is 23

Therefore, x+2y+9=23

3x+6=2y+18

3x2y=12

3x2(x+7)=12

x14=12

x=26

y=26+7=33 (from (1))

Therefore, the fraction is 2633
